What type of internet should I choose in Waco?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Waco you live. If speed is your main concern, fiber will be the fastest internet in the city.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 57.65% of Waco homes.
- Cable is fastest for 35.98% of the city.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for 1.93%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for 4.44% of Waco homes.
Internet Market Health in Waco

Internet Competition Key
The map shows how competitive the Waco internet service market is. Areas in green have more alternatives, areas in yellow have a few choices, and areas in red may have only one provider. More competition usually means faster speeds and better prices for you, the customer.
Below are quick facts on internet competition and market health in Waco based on what connections the average home has availabile:
- Average number of internet service providers to a home: 8.6 (very healthy)
- Average types of service (fiber, cable, DSL, etc): 3.2 (very healthy)
- Average providers with broadband (25 Mbps+) speeds: 7.7 (very healthy)
Overall, competition is very healthy.
Waco internet customers have the ability to buy internet service from 1 to 14 different providers, depending on where they live. For different types of service, Waco homes have between 1 and 4 options. The type(s) of service available are fixed wireless, cable, fiber, and dsl, though these may vary depending on the region within the city.
When it comes to broadband download speeds faster than 25 Mbps, the situation is worse. Waco internet customers who want faster speeds have between 1 and 12 choices of companies offering speeds up to or over 25 Mbps.
More internet companies with faster speeds means fewer monopolies and better prices for customers. In promoting a free market for internet, Waco is doing quite well.
